When installing Splunk MINT on a cluster, why do I get "Your MINT license has not been added yet."?

I have deployed the Mint App to each of my Search Heads and the TA to each indexer and my Heavy forwarder. When I look on the license server, it shows two licenses: the Splunk Enterprise license and Splunk Mint Term license. When I go to a search head and go to the Mint app, the wizard pops up and says "Your MINT license has not been added yet. Upload it here". That link takes me to the Licensing on the search head which shows I am pointed to the license master and Show all config details shows two license keys.

Any other thoughts?

With the release of MINT App 2.2, a MINT licenses is no longer required for Splunk Enterprise customers to use MINT App. For details, see MINT App docs.
